G Mining Ventures Corp. (GMIN) - Total Liabilities

Latest as of September 2025: CA$595.22 Million CAD

Based on the latest financial reports, G Mining Ventures Corp. (GMIN) has total liabilities worth CA$595.22 Million CAD as of September 2025.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Annual Total Liabilities for G Mining Ventures Corp. (2018–2024)

The table below shows the annual total liabilities of G Mining Ventures Corp. from 2018 to 2024.

Year Total Liabilities Change
2024-12-31 CA$462.83 Million +43.59%
2023-12-31 CA$322.33 Million +1983.60%
2022-12-31 CA$15.47 Million +485.73%
2021-12-31 CA$2.64 Million +3996.37%
2020-12-31 CA$64.47K +20.52%
2019-12-31 CA$53.50K -11.85%
2018-12-31 CA$60.69K --

About

G Mining Ventures Corp., a mining company, engages in the acquisition, exploration, and development of precious metal projects. Its flagship property is Tocantinzinho Gold Project located in State of Pará, Brazil. G Mining Ventures Corp. was incorporated in 2017 and is based in Québec, Canada.
